Public Transportation Black Boxes to Identify Motorcycle Violations

SEOUL, April 28 (Korea Bizwire) — Starting next month, black boxes in taxis and buses will be used to track illegal activities such as motorcycles operating on sidewalks or bicycle paths. Gov’t Calls on Citizens to Use Online Notarial System to Maintain Social Distancing

SEOUL, April 28 (Korea Bizwire) — The Ministry of Justice on Monday asked citizens to make use of an online notarial system instead of visiting government offices in person. Gov’t to Increase Penalties for Digital Sex Offenses

SEOUL, April 23 (Korea Bizwire) — South Korea’s government on Thursday announced new get-tough measures against digital sex crimes, vowing to push to punish even buyers, advertisers and possessors of child and youth sexual abuse materials, as well as their producers and sellers.
